Avelox for Pneumonia User Reviews (Page 2)

Avelox has an average rating of 8.1 out of 10 from a total of 38 reviews for the treatment of Pneumonia. 71% of reviewers reported a positive experience, while 5% reported a negative experience.

"I asked my doctor for Avalox for my pneumonia, but she told me that I cannot take it (I had it before with a doc that DIDN'T warn me that I can't take it) because I have Hypothyroidism and am on Thyroxine. I wondered why so looked it up. It keeps your body from properly taking on the Thyroxine. You end up with hair loss, itching, etc. (all the hypothyroid problems). I'm upset because it worked so well for me in the past for chest infection. So back to double doses of Amoxicillin (makes me sick) THREE times per day"
